Vladimir Putin today staged drills with his road-launched intercontinental nuclear Yars missiles in a forest in western Siberia. The 7,500 mile range of the missiles means they would be capable of striking Britain or anywhere in Europe. The tests come amid high tension with the West over the Ukraine war, and the near-daily threats by Putin’s propagandists to deploy atomic weapons. “Over 100 pieces of hardware are taking part in the exercise,” said a statement from the Russian defence… – UK Mirror Photo: Sputnik / Vadim Savitskii
